Chisipite plc has been listed on a stock exchange for 30 years and now has a large number of diverse shareholders none of whom exceeds a 5% stake. It has sought to raise the annual dividend per share by at least 1% per annum and has never cut its dividend even during years of low profits. The company now has a new chief executive officer who wishes to quickly develop the company through a major project. Summarised financial statements for the last financial year for Chisipite plc Income statement £'000 Revenue 1,000,000 Cost of sales ( 550,000) Gross profit 450,000 Overhead expenses ( 220,000) Operating profit 230,000 Interest payable ( 50,000) Profits before tax 180,000 Corporation tax ( 36,000) Earnings 144,000 Dividends ( 90,000) Retained earnings 54,000 Statement of financial position Share capital 25,000 Share premium 250,000 Retained earnings 300,000 Total equity 575,000 Non-current liabilities 10 year loan notes 5% 1,000,000 Capital employed 1,575,000 Other information Current share price £ 60.00 Interest rate on loan notes 5.0% Beta factor for Chisipite plc 1.14 Equity risk premium 3.4% Yield on government bonds 2.3% Gross profit margin 45.0% Tax rate 20.0% NEED TO CALCULATE  1 Calculate Chisipite’s cost of equity capital using the capital asset pricing model. Calculate the weighted average cost of capital and use this to calculate the net present value of the project. 2 Calculate Chisipite plc’s capital gearing ratio, interest cover ratio and dividend cover ratio for the last financial year.
